The Great Gatsby Movie

The movie version of The Great Gatsby stayed true to its roots and did not change the story line or plot. The story, characters, events, and everything else was kept the same. The main actors were Leonardo Dicaprio playing Gatsby, Carey Mulligan as Daisy, Tobey Maguire as Nick Carraway, and Joel Edgerton as Tom Buchanan. The cast did a wonderful job playing their roles, keeping each character as stuck up as the other. The soundtrack could have been better, but since Jay-Z was a producer, some rap songs turned jazz were to be expected. The music was not the only thing that took away some of the atmosphere, as the movie was extremely fast moving and filled with effects and color at the start. The movie began to slow down near the end, but the beginning was the hardest part to follow. Emotions fill the movie ranging from happiness, to sadness and anger. The movie's quality was great and shot beautifully, and the 1920's were represented accurately, going from the clothing to the buildings and cars. I would recommend the movie to anyone interested in watching it, and would also recommend it to people who have read the book, as this is a completely different experience.

Man Buried With Motorcycle

"Billy Standley Buried Astride His Motorcycle Inside Enormous Plexiglass Box, Riding Beloved Harley To Heaven"
From: The Huffington Post
By: The Huffington Post


Bill Standley, a 82 year old Ohio man who recently passed, is having his family fulfill one of his last wishes. Bill absolutely loved his 1967 Harley Davidson Electra Glide Cruiser, which he had custom work put into. His family said that he would use that as his only means of transportation, and was not able to be away from it. The family needed a extra large cemetery plot to fit a large plexiglas case that contained Bill riding his motorcycle one last time. He was given a metal back brace and straps to ensure that he would not get off the seat. Bill made his living starting off at thirteen, from being a ranch boy and bull rider. He said that his motorcycle was the last way to retain a sense of adventure and exploration from his youth. "He was a quirky man," his daughter Dorothy said. "But when it comes to us kids, he loved us, he raised us well and, of course, we wanted to help him." What is most impressive, is that he himself started the project. Bill made the plexiglas case and decided how to fashion himself onto the seat to make sure he would not fall. All of his family and biker friends were invited to see his final ride.
